Landlords have to handle down payment according to state and neighborhood laws, which often dictate just how down payments are accumulated, kept, and returned. This consists of maintaining down payments in separate, interest-bearing accounts and offering renters with written paperwork of any type of reductions made for repair services or damages. Ideal techniques for taking care of down payment entail maintaining openness and open communication with lessees.
In situations of disagreements over safety and security deposits, having a well-documented process for returning down payments and dealing with renter issues is vital. Along with federal legislations, building supervisors have to know state and regional policies that control rental buildings. These legislations can vary substantially and may consist of particular demands for safety and security down payments, lease agreements, expulsion processes, and property maintenance.
